Information Assortment & Instrumentation
Correct reporting depends closely on exact information assortment from dependable climate stations and devices. These devices, together with thermometers, barometers, anemometers, and hygrometers, have to be correctly calibrated and maintained. The position of those devices inside Brooklyn is essential, as variations in terrain and proximity to the coast can considerably affect native climate patterns. As an example, temperatures can fluctuate significantly between inland neighborhoods and people straight on the waterfront.

3. Hyperlocal Focus
Hyperlocal focus distinguishes reporting particular to Brooklyn from broader city-wide or regional forecasts. Climate situations can fluctuate considerably inside a comparatively small geographic space as a consequence of elements like proximity to water, elevation adjustments, and concrete warmth island results. This microclimate variability necessitates extremely localized info for efficient decision-making. As an example, a temperature distinction of a number of levels or variations in precipitation depth between neighborhoods can considerably influence decisions relating to out of doors actions, commuting, and even emergency preparedness. Understanding these localized nuances is the cornerstone of hyperlocal climate reporting, making it distinct and important for Brooklyn residents.
The sensible significance of this hyperlocal focus is obvious in a number of situations. Take into account a situation involving localized flooding as a consequence of intense rainfall. A hyperlocal report can pinpoint the precise streets and neighborhoods most in danger, enabling residents to take preemptive measures and emergency providers to deploy sources successfully. Equally, throughout heatwaves, hyperlocal information highlighting temperature variations inside Brooklyn can inform public well being initiatives, directing sources like cooling facilities to probably the most susceptible communities. This granular method to climate reporting empowers people and communities to reply extra successfully to weather-related challenges, enhancing security and enhancing resilience.

5. Extreme Climate Alerts
Extreme climate alerts represent a essential element of localized climate reporting for Brooklyn. These alerts present well timed warnings about probably hazardous meteorological occasions, enabling residents to take proactive measures to guard life and property. The connection between extreme climate alerts and a devoted information service for Brooklyn arises from the distinctive vulnerabilities of this densely populated city atmosphere. Coastal storms, flash floods, blizzards, and warmth waves can pose vital threats, necessitating fast and focused dissemination of warnings. Efficient communication of those alerts is essential for minimizing the influence of extreme climate, making certain public security, and enhancing group resilience.
Actual-life examples underscore the important function of those alerts. Throughout Hurricane Sandy, well timed warnings broadcast by native information channels enabled many Brooklyn residents to evacuate low-lying areas earlier than the storm surge inundated coastal communities. Equally, advance warnings about approaching extreme thunderstorms or tornadoes present essential time for residents to hunt shelter and safe property. The sensible significance of this understanding lies within the potential to mitigate the devastating penalties of maximum climate occasions. Correct and well timed dissemination of alerts permits people, households, and communities to make knowledgeable selections that may defend lives and reduce injury.
